Community Tasting Notes 3

  • kanjimoti wrote: 91 points

    January 18, 2015 - Super saturated purple, I mean teeth staining. I'm drinking the wine and writing this note while watching the Packers/Seahawks game. Nose of ash, deep black fruit, glycerin, and a tertiary note only time can bring. The palate is well balanced and delicious. I'm pleasantly surprised here. The oak has integrated well. This will give pleasure at least another five years. I'll say drink the '04 Jericho by Spring, 2020.

  • kurishin wrote: 86 points

    July 8, 2012 - I extended the drinkability end date on this to 2017. The wine is still quite young, with tannins and fresh fruit. Not much acidity, which makes me wonder how this will continue to age but the oak has melded well with the fruit at this point. There was just little complexity and that is part of the reason to move the date to 2017 to give this wine a chance to develop something interesting. The fruit is a bit jammy--berry compote comes to mind.

  • MJTed wrote: 90 points

    December 21, 2009 - Dark and somewhat brooding- demonstrating secondary characteristics of minerals, tobacco and herb on top of dreid currant fruit. dense and seomwhat tannic.
